Hi, I’m Tristan!
I’m a lifeguard and swim instructor with nearly 10 years of experience teaching swimming lessons to people of all ages and abilities. My love for swimming began at a young age, and over the years, I’ve developed a passion for sharing my knowledge and skills with others to help them feel confident and safe in the water.
I started Aquanauts Swim Academy on Vancouver Island to create a swim academy that combines high-quality, personalized instruction with a sense of adventure and discovery. Our mission is to empower swimmers of all ages to build water confidence, master safety skills, and explore their potential—whether it’s their first splash in the pool or working toward lifelong swimming goals.
One of my proudest accomplishments has been coaching athletes through the Special Olympics, where I’ve seen the transformative power of swimming in building confidence, improving physical fitness, and achieving personal milestones. This experience inspires me every day to make AquaNauts a place where everyone feels supported and encouraged, no matter their starting point.
I also love combining the elements of learn to swim with infant survival rescue—watching little ones discover the joy of swimming while learning to be incredibly safe and begin self-rescue is one of the most rewarding parts of what I do. I aim to create a fun, patient, and positive learning environment where students of all ages feel comfortable, excited, and motivated to learn.
Swimming is more than a skill—it’s a life-saving ability and a gateway to lifelong health and enjoyment. My goal with AquaNauts Swim Academy is to make swimming accessible, enjoyable, and enriching for everyone.

Hi! I’m Erica, and I’ve been teaching kids to swim and love the water for over 20 years.
I was a competitive synchronized swimmer my entire life and started coaching synchronized swimming in 2003 and have worked with athletes of all ages and abilities. One of the highlights of my career was coaching the Jamaican National Synchronized Swimming Team! Along the way, I’ve also spent more than 15 years working as a lifeguard and swim instructor in recreation centres, helping kids build strong swimming skills and confidence in the water.
Outside of the pool, I’ve worked in local daycares and spent many years supporting children in different environments. And perhaps my most important experience—I’m also a mom to four kids myself! That perspective helps me bring patience, encouragement, and lots of fun to every lesson.
Whether your child is just starting out or looking to improve their skills, my goal is always the same: help them feel safe, confident, and proud of what they can do in the water.
